收藏
回答

wx.downloadFile 清除缓存以后再运行小程序,此方法就直接fail报错?

报错信息为:"downloadFile:fail Error: ENOENT: no such file or directory, open 'C:\Users\Administrator\AppData\Local\微信开发者工具\User Data\8e3c9a4c80bda5bf8b2d5f0dc11b0f27\WeappSimulator\WeappFileSystem\o6zAJs-ObCuI9J8lUirVaoFx3xGI\wx96821e645ac5476b\tmp\npmRxmrRqMfra0f6c9d27c0648e517b399174fde48c7.png'""downloadFile:fail Error: ENOENT: no such file or directory, open 'C:\Users\Administrator\AppData\Local\微信开发者工具\User Data\8e3c9a4c80bda5bf8b2d5f0dc11b0f27\WeappSimulator\WeappFileSystem\o6zAJs-ObCuI9J8lUirVaoFx3xGI\wx96821e645ac5476b\tmp\npmRxmrRqMfra0f6c9d27c0648e517b399174fde48c7.png'"

回答关注问题邀请回答
收藏

5 个回答

  • 社区技术运营专员--阳光
    社区技术运营专员--阳光
    2021-09-08

    请具体描述问题出现的流程,并提供能复现问题的简单代码片段(https://developers.weixin.qq.com/miniprogram/dev/devtools/minicode.html)。

    2021-09-08
    有用
    回复 4
    • 冰
      2021-09-09
      在开发者工具中,清除全部缓存,重新运行小程序。在需要下载网络图片的时候,wx.downloadFile方法就是执行失败。
      2021-09-09
      回复
    • 冰
      2021-09-09
      关闭开发者工具,重新打开项目,重新运行,就正常了。
      2021-09-09
      回复
    • 社区技术运营专员--阳光
      社区技术运营专员--阳光
      2021-09-09回复
      重新运行后还会出现吗
      2021-09-09
      回复
    • 冰
      2021-09-09
      重新运行就好了。然后再清楚全部缓存,又出现了。还需要关闭开发者工具,重新打开项目。总的来说就是,只要全部清除缓存,就会出现这个问题,必须要关掉开发者工具重新打开。
      2021-09-09
      1
      回复
  • 乐子人、
    乐子人、
    2022-04-20

    同上,求解决方案!

    2022-04-20
    有用
    回复
  • 努力
    努力
    2021-10-28

    同上

    2021-10-28
    有用
    回复
  • 羊
    2021-10-21

    同样问题,等待官方解决

    2021-10-21
    有用
    回复
  • 素笺
    素笺
    2021-09-14

    同样问题,清除全部缓存再编译,downloadFile就报downloadFile:fail Error: ENOENT: no such file or directory, open'xxxxxxx'错误,搞了好久没解决掉,楼主解决了吗

    2021-09-14
    有用
    回复 1
    • 素笺
      素笺
      2021-09-14
      首次会报错,再去重新调用downloadFile就又正常了,再去清除缓存编译调用downloadFile,又会报错
      2021-09-14
      回复
登录 后发表内容